As the Live out Loud Campaign crosses the halfway point, it is a good time to reexamine the vision we have for the campaign and its purpose.
It is tempting for us to get caught thinking that reaching the two million dollar goal or building the new dining hall is the reason why we are holding this campaign. I must remind myself that the campaign total and the new buildings are a means to an end and not an end in themselves.
Changing lives is the end. Showing campers that faith can be fun is the end. Creating a safe place where kids feel free to be themselves is the end. Forming the future leaders of the Church is the end. These are the reasons to give to the campaign.
What these buildings will do is allow us to reach more
lives and to do so more efficiently and effectively. For example, the new dining
hall, despite being substantially larger, will cost less to heat than Helen Hall
does currently. These savings can create more scholarships or strengthen our
programs. Also, with a more efficient kitchen, cooking and clean up will require
less time, allowing the kitchen crew to be more available to help with the
campers during the summer. All these small benefits add up. They add up to a
more powerful experience that touches the lives of more people each year.
